## Further reading

Stagegrid renders seat maps for the Ferncliff Playhouse booking flow. Before touching layout code, read up on zone geometry, accessibility seat handling, and the SVG caching layer — all three interact in non-obvious ways. Start with the architecture overview, then the rendering pipeline notes, both collected on the internal page below.

dashboard of yafog-fajof = https://jira.tolvaqsys.internal/pages/pages/projects/49fe21c4

## Add `taillog`, an internal CLI for tailing service logs

Hey release crew — this adds `taillog`, a small CLI for streaming logs from the Copperline aggregator without needing dashboard access. It handles reconnects, multi-service fan-in, and a `--since` flag that actually works. Nothing here touches prod config, but it does ship with hardcoded defaults for buffering and reconnect behavior, so flag it in the release notes. For the record, those defaults are listed below.

constants for hahof-bajep:
THRESHOLDS = {
    "sorwyn": 797,
    "jorath": 933,
    "pramir": 998,
    "wenath": 950,
    "silok": 489,
    "prawyn": 572,
    "praiel": 821,
}

Handover Note — Project Lanthorn

Board: acquisition talks with Merrow Dynamics are at term-sheet stage. Valuation range agreed in principle; diligence starts next month. Key risk: their Calder facility lease. Incoming lead is Director Yusra Fennel; she has full file access. No external advisors engaged yet. Treat as strictly confidential. Strategic rationale is stated below.

board note of bawep-tajef: Queniusek Systems plans to raise the Quenvan list price by 53.1 percent in March. The pricing group signed off on a budget of $176.4 million for Project Drueth. The renewal with Casionix Partners closes at $142.5 million a year, 8.3 percent below the last contract. Project Fraax slips by six weeks because of the tooling delay.